2 次代码提交 0ac0c7a7a7 ... 1f86e203aa

作者 SHA1 备注 提交日期
  ixueaedu 1f86e203aa update 2 年之前
  ixueaedu 0033b89ce3 update 2 年之前
共有 5 个文件被更改,包括 23 次插入0 次删除
  1. 二进制
      __pycache__/merge_two_lists.cpython-39-pytest-7.1.1.pyc
  2. 二进制
      __pycache__/merge_two_lists.cpython-39.pyc
  3. 11 0
      array/single_Number.py
  4. 7 0
      draft.py
  5. 5 0
      generat_matrix.py

二进制
__pycache__/merge_two_lists.cpython-39-pytest-7.1.1.pyc


二进制
__pycache__/merge_two_lists.cpython-39.pyc


+ 11 - 0
array/single_Number.py

@@ -0,0 +1,11 @@
+from typing import List
+
+# 异或运算有以下三个性质。
+# 任何数和 00 做异或运算,结果仍然是原来的数,即 a ⊕ 0=a。
+# 任何数和其自身做异或运算,结果是 00,即 a ⊕ a = 0。
+# 异或运算满足交换律和结合律
+def singleNumber(self, nums: List[int]) -> int:
+    arr = 0
+    for i in nums:
+        arr ^= i
+    return arr

+ 7 - 0
draft.py

@@ -1,4 +1,11 @@
+<<<<<<< HEAD
+import numpy as np
+n = 3
+m = np.array(range(1, (n * n) + 1)).reshape(n, n)
+print(m)
+=======
 s = "A man, a plan, a canal: Panama".lower()
 b = ''.join(ch for ch in s if ch.isalnum()).lower()
 print(b)
 
+>>>>>>> 0ac0c7a7a7ace7b2c81857019fe6ed8ad32cad09

+ 5 - 0
generat_matrix.py

@@ -0,0 +1,5 @@
+from typing import List
+import numpy as np
+
+def generateMatrix(self, n: int) -> List[List[int]]:
+    m = np.array(range(1, (n * n) + 1)).reshape(n, n)